Juego interactivo con Leap Motion
Subirana Garcia, Cristina
Martí Godia, Enric, dir. (Universitat Autònoma de Barcelona. Departament de Ciències de la Computació)
Universitat Autònoma de Barcelona. Escola d'Enginyeria

Additional title: Leap Motion interactive game
Additional title: Joc interactiu amb Leap Motion
Date: 2015-06-29
Abstract: Leap Motion está diseñado para el reconocimiento 3D gestual de nuestras manos. Por lo tanto, la versatilidad de esta tecnología es muy grande, ya que hay muchas aplicaciones de campos muy diferentes en los cuales el uso de gestos puede facilitar la interacción persona-máquina. La motivación principal de este proyecto fue poder ver todas las posibilidades del dispositivo para manipular entornos 3D. Se trabajó con objetos 3D en la Asignatura "Visualització Gràfica Interactiva", creando un aplicativo Visual C++ que hace uso de la librería gráfica OpenGL. Los dispositivos de entrada utilizados en este aplicativo eran ratón y teclado, mediante los cuales se podía manipular el objeto 3D. Por ello, la idea de este proyecto es aprender el funcionamiento del dispositivo Leap Motion para crear y probar un lenguaje gestual que permita interaccionar con objetos 3D. De esta manera, se añaden nuevas funcionalidades al aplicativo y aquellas que se hacían mediante ratón y teclado se podrán hacer con el uso de gestos mediante Leap Motion.
Abstract: Leap Motion is designed to recognize 3D gestures of our hands. There are so many fields where Leap Motion could make a difference, as the use of gestures could change the way people interact with machines. Learning all the possibilities Leap Motion can bring to 3D object manipulation was the main motivation of this project. We had worked with 3D objects at "Visualització Gràfica Interactiva " lectures. We did a Visual C++ application, using OpenGL graphics library. This application had mouse and keyboard as input devices. 3D objects were manipulated by these devices. This project is based on this idea, learning how Leap Motion works in order to create and test a gesture language that let us interact with 3D objects. Thus, new functionalities are added to this application, and others (which were previously activated by mouse or keyboard) will use Leap Motion as an input device.
Abstract: Leap Motion està dissenyat pel reconeixement 3D gestual de les nostres mans. Per tant, la versatilitat d'aquesta tecnologia es molt amplia, ja que hi ha moltes aplicacions de camps molt diferents en les que l'ús de gestos pot facilitar la interacció persona-màquina. La motivació principal d'aquest projecte ha sigut poder veure totes les possibilitats del dispositiu per a manipular entorns 3D. Es va treballar amb objectes 3D a l'Assignatura "Visualització Gràfica Interactiva", creant una aplicació Visual C++ que feia ús de la llibreria gràfica OpenGL. Els dispositius d'entrada en aquesta aplicació eren mouse i teclat, mitjançant els quals es podia manipular l'objecte 3D. Per tant, la idea d'aquest projecte és aprendre el funcionament del dispositiu Leap Motion per a crear i provar un llenguatge gestual que permeti interaccionar amb objectes 3D. Així, s'afegeixen noves funcionalitats a l'aplicació i aquelles que es feien mitjançant mouse i teclat es faran amb l'ús de gestos mitjançant Leap Motion.
Rights: Aquest document està subjecte a una llicència d'ús Creative Commons. Es permet la reproducció total o parcial i la comunicació pública de l'obra, sempre que no sigui amb finalitats comercials, i sempre que es reconegui l'autoria de l'obra original. No es permet la creació d'obres derivades. Creative Commons
Language: Castellà
Studies: Grau en Enginyeria Informàtica [2502441]
Study plan: Enginyeria Informàtica [958]
Document: Treball final de grau ; Text
Subject area: Menció Computació
Subject: Aplicació Visual Studio amb Leap Motion ; Joc en OpenGL amb Leap Motion ; Reconeixement gestual 3D ; Transformacions 3D amb Leap Motion ; Aplicación Visual Studio con Leap Motion ; Juego en OpenGL con Leap Motion ; Reconocimiento gestual 3D ; Transformaciones 3D con Leap Motion ; 3D gesture recognition ; 3D transformations with Leap Motion ; OpenGL Game on Leap Motion ; Visual Studio app on Leap Motion



9 p, 904.1 KB

The record appears in these collections:
Research literature > Bachelor's degree final project > School of Engineering. TFG

 Record created 2015-11-19, last modified 2023-07-22



   Favorit i Compartir